Compliance of NKF KDOQI 2020 nutrition guideline recommendations with other guideline recommendations and protein energy wasting criteria in hemodialysis patients

© 2022 Société francophone de néphrologie, dialyse et transplantationIntroduction: Nutrition in hemodialysis patients is important in decreasing complications, improving quality of life, and preventing of malnutrition. Recommendations of the guidelines are taken into consideration while prescribing a nutrition therapy plan for patients. However, the recommendations may differ between the guidelines. It was aimed to compare the newly published National Kidney Foundation Kidney Disease Outcomes Quality Initiative (NKF KDOQI) guideline with previous reported two guideline recommendations and protein energy wasting criteria in this study. Materials and methods: Fifty-five maintenance hemodialysis patients between the ages of 18–65 were included in the study. Daily energy intake and daily protein intake of these patients were evaluated by three different nutrition guidelines; NKF KDOQI-2000, 2020 and European Best Practice Guidelines-2007. In addition, protein energy wasting was determined by using anthropometric measurements, biochemical findings and food intake of the patients. Results: When the inadequacy rate in dietary daily energy intake and daily protein intake of the patients evaluated by NKF KDOQI-2000 recommendations, it was found to be higher than the rates in other two recommendations (P < 0.05). Based on criteria, protein energy wasting was detected in 29.1% of the patients. While the NKF KDOQI-2020 daily energy intake recommendation was not consistent with other guideline recommendations, it seems highly compatible with protein energy wasting recommendations such as albumin, body mass index, mid-upper arm circumference, energy, and protein intake. While NKF KDOQI-2020 daily protein intake recommendation complies with European Best Practice Guidelines-2007 recommendations, the level of agreement with protein energy wasting criteria is very low. Conclusion: Inadequate protein intake is still an ongoing problem in hemodialysis patients. NKF KDOQI-2020 guidelines provide a more suitable and applicable daily energy intake recommendation for patients compared to the previous guidelines.
